The Rise of Instant, Accessible Play Experiences

One notable trend in the industry is the increasing demand for instant, anytime-access gaming experiences. Historically, gaming required significant hardware investments or downloads, creating barriers for casual players seeking quick entertainment. Today, cloud gaming and browser-based games are redefining these constraints, allowing players to jump into high-quality games without lengthy downloads or expensive equipment.

Within this landscape, platforms that offer seamless, instant access to diverse gaming experiences are gaining prominence. They leverage advanced web technologies and streaming services to deliver near-instant gameplay, catering to the modern consumer’s expectation for immediacy. This evolution underscores an industry shift towards more inclusive, accessible gaming environments.

Data-Driven Design and Player-Centric Innovation

The integration of analytics and user feedback into game design is revolutionizing how developers create compelling content. Data insights inform everything from difficulty balancing to feature prioritization, resulting in more personalized and satisfying experiences. A recent industry report indicates that platforms incorporating real-time analytics report a 20-30% higher retention rate, underscoring the importance of understanding player behavior.

This approach aligns with broader trends emphasizing player agency and customization. Interactive environments now often feature adaptive AI, dynamic content updates, and social integrations that foster ongoing engagement. As the industry continues to evolve, such data-driven, player-centric strategies will be fundamental in maintaining relevance and competitive advantage.

The Future of Gaming: Beyond the Screen

Looking ahead, the integration of virtual reality (VR), augmented reality (AR), and AI-driven personalization signals a future where gaming becomes even more immersive and individualized. These advancements herald a shift from static experiences to dynamic, adaptive worlds that can respond to player emotions, choices, and social contexts.

Moreover, the proliferation of cloud technology facilitates cross-platform play, allowing users to transition seamlessly between devices and environments. This interconnectedness enhances community-building and supports the rise of open ecosystems that prioritize user empowerment.
